Sucker Fishing

  • 59213 335th Street Warroad, MN, 56763 United States (map)
  • Google Calendar ICS

Suckers navigate up tributaries from Lake of the Woods on their journey to reproduce. This yearly event only happens a few weeks each year.

If you have ever been interested in Sucker Fishing and how it is done this is an opportunity you will not want to miss. Come learn and watch Tim Paquin pull his sucker nets and see what he has caught.
